A multidisciplinary team made by researchers coming from the Istituto Italiano di Tecnologia, the Center for Synaptic Neuroscience of Genoa and the Center for Nanoscience and Technology of Milan, in collaboration with a group of researchers coordinated by Chiara Bertarelli, Department of Chemistry, Materials and Chemical Engineering “Giulio Natta”, has just published on «Nature Nanotechnology» a project about an innovative molecule (Ziapin) able to make neurons responsive to the light.

Thanks to Ziapin, it will be easier to study how human brain works and, in the upcoming future, it will possible to adopt new therapies for nervous system pathologies or degenerative diseases of the retina.
